Description

The U.S. Army Contracting Command - Redstone Arsenal (ACC-RSA) is issuing this Sources Sought Notice (SSN) as a means of conducting market research to identify parties having an interest in and the resources to support contractor logistic support (CLS) and engineering services for the Containerized Weapon System (CWS), the CWS - Advanced Precision Kill Weapon System (CWS-A), and the Serenity system. This requirement consists of sustainment services including Continental United States (CONUS) and Outside Continental United States (OCONUS) field support representatives (FSR), repair and maintenance, training, and related shipping and travel. Additionally, this requirement will include engineering, development, integration, and testing associated with emerging requirements for the CWS, CWS-A, and Serenity systems. PROGRAM BACKGROUND



It is contemplated that this award will be made to Invariant Corporation, utilizing other than a Full and Open Competition (FAOC) approach in accordance with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) 6.302-1, Only One Responsible Source. The anticipated performance period for this requirement is 36 months from the date of award. The proposed acquisition is for the requirements depicted in the following paragraphs:





REQUIRED CAPABILITIES



The effort includes CLS requirements for training, FSRs, and repair and maintenance services in support of the program. In detail, the Government requires:






  • Training – Provide contractor support of new equipment training (NET) for each system at Government locations in the form of on-site contractor personnel, support equipment, and instruction materials required to certify new operators.






  • FSR Support – Provide on-site contractor personnel at CONUS/OCONUS locations to provide necessary NET, sustainment training, repair and maintenance, software updates, and technical support required to maintain all the required capabilities for deployed units.






  • Repair and Maintenance – Provide on-site contractor personnel, equipment, expertise, and repair materials required to provide repair and maintenance support for CWS, CWS-A, and the Serenity system including all activities required to bring elements of each weapon system to a fully mission capable status.






  • Shipping - Provide coverage for shipment of necessary equipment from the contractor’s facility to Government CONUS and OCONUS destinations.






  • Travel - Provide coverage for contractor personnel to travel in support of the contract requirements.






  • Engineering Services - Provide engineering support in the form of software and hardware engineering, system development, system integration, and component and system level testing.
